What Does It Mean When Your Cat Smells Everything?
When a cat smells everything, it is trying to familiarize itself with its surroundings. By getting a good whiff of everything in its environment, the cat can identify what belongs there and what doesn’t.
This helps the cat feel more comfortable and secure in its surroundings. In addition to helping the cat feel at ease, smelling everything also allows the cat to gather information about its surroundings.
For example, if there are other animals nearby, the cat may be able to pick up on their scent and determine whether they are friends or foes. Similarly, if there are any dangerous chemicals or substances present, the cat will be able to smell them and stay away from them.
So, when your cat smells everything, it is simply trying to get a better understanding of its surroundings and make sure that it feels comfortable there.

Conclusion
Your cat’s habit of smelling everything may seem odd to you, but it’s actually part of their natural instincts. Cats have a very sensitive sense of smell, and they use it to learn about their surroundings and the people and animals in it.
When your cat smells something, they are trying to figure out what it is and if it is safe. This is why you often see cats sniffing new things or people when they meet them for the first time.
It’s also why cats like to rub their faces on things – they are marking their territory with their scent. So next time your cat is giving everything a good sniff, don’t be too alarmed – they’re just doing what comes naturally!
